Saturday night I watched a movie entitled Push. A young girl (played by Dakota Fanning) was called a “watcher” because she could see the future.

I did not write down her exact quote but she stated that the future was always changing. She said something like this: “The future can change greatly, because of a small change now.”

I have been thinking about how true this has been in my life. I suppose it is one of the reasons I have never put a lot of stock in fortune tellers. What I do today affects my world tomorrow. There is very little, about my future which is locked in stone. Of course, some of what I have done in the past may still have future consequences, living in linear form sort of requires that each action has a reaction, but everything can change with just a slightly different thought and/or action.

This morning I was cleaning out old email and I found a Secret to Peace I wrote four years ago entitled “Shift Happens.” I am going to finish today’s offering by reprinting that writing.

I recently read a quote by Sharon Salzberg, who is one of the co-founders of the Insight Meditation Society, which said, “Life is like an ever shifting kaleidoscope – a slight change, and all patterns alter.”

This has been my experience.

I have noticed, over the past twenty plus years that in conjunction with each shift in consciousness, my whole world changes, often dramatically.

My life shifts, with each new awareness, as if it were some type of three dimensional kaleidoscope.

All of the sudden, people once important to me, no longer fit in my life; activities I once held dear, are no longer attractive.

I have even seen changes in my physical body, changes in my career options, and changes in all types of relationships as a result of even a minor shift in my consciousness.

I have attracted people and opportunities beyond my grandest dreams.

What an incredible adventure this life is.

I have always been thrilled by kaleidoscopes.

So, what is the secret to peace in this message?

Simply that your whole world shifts when you do. If you are not seeing peace in your world, make the shift within. The world, you see, has no choice but to respond in kind.
